OTHER INFORMATION<br />

5. Purchase of subsidiary companies and disposal of associated companies<br />

1994<br />

<strong>Benetton</strong> International N.V. acquired for £.11,000,000 (approximately Lire 28,000 million) full control over<br />

<strong>Benetton</strong> Engineering Ltd. from a subsidiary of Edizione Holding S.p.A.. <strong>The</strong> acquired company owns a<br />

50% stake in TWR <strong>Group</strong> Ltd., which has been treated as a subsidiary since the <strong>Benetton</strong> <strong>Group</strong> controls<br />

the majority of voting rights at ordinary meetings. TWR <strong>Group</strong> Ltd. principally designs and develops<br />

prototype racing cars.<br />

Among <strong>Group</strong> companies in Italy, the interest in Azimut S.p.A., a company involved in the shirt and<br />

blouse production and distribution activities, was increased from 50% to 75%. <strong>The</strong> same reorganization<br />

involved the disposal to third parties of the <strong>Group</strong>’s interests (50% in both cases) in Altana Uno S.p.A.<br />

and Columbia S.p.A., non-operating companies whose shirt-sector activities had previously been<br />

transferred to Azimut S.p.A..<br />

Texcontrol S.p.A. added to its manufacturing capacity by acquiring 100% of F.T. Srl, based in Follina<br />

(Treviso), a company specializing in the dyeing of wool fabrics. Two newly-formed wholly-owned<br />

subsidiaries also commenced operations under business rental agreements: Finitex S.p.A. specializes in<br />

the dyeing and printing of woven fabrics, and Tessuti di Pordenone S.p.A. is active in weaving.<br />

Galli Filati S.p.A., which manufactures and distributes carded woolen yarns, expanded by acquiring a<br />

plant in Caserta that specializes in the processing of this type of yarn.<br />

<strong>The</strong> <strong>Group</strong> increased from 50% to 90% its investment in <strong>Benetton</strong> <strong>Group</strong> Japan K.K..<br />

1995<br />

In pursuit of increasing efficiency among the manufacturing subsidiaries of the <strong>Group</strong>, Manifatture<br />

Stefani S.p.A. acquired from Texcontrol S.p.A. 100% of Finitex S.p.A. and 100% of Tessuti di Pordenone<br />

S.p.A..<br />

Maglificio Fontane S.p.A., now 75% owned by <strong>Benetton</strong> <strong>Group</strong>, acquired a 81% controlling interest in<br />

Maglifici Re.Mo. S.p.A. and took over this company’s activities in the processing of woolen knitwear.<br />

Maglifici Re.Mo. S.p.A. has since ceased operating.<br />

<strong>Benetton</strong> <strong>Group</strong> increased its 75% holding in Azimut S.p.A. to 100%, via the purchase from third parties of<br />

the remaining shares, and started direct production and distribution of shirts and blouses.<br />

Galli Filati S.p.A., completed the acquisition of 100% of the capital stock of Filma S.p.A., based in<br />

Valdagno (Vicenza), thereby adding the manufacture and processing of worsted woolen yarns to its<br />

range of activities.<br />

In the context of the program to strengthen and diversify the wool sector production cycle, Galli<br />

Filati S.p.A. also purchased a 50%-interest in the capital stock of Spiller S.p.A., based in Schio (Vicenza),<br />

which is active in raw materials and in wool and mixed-fiber fabrics.<br />

<strong>The</strong> <strong>Group</strong>'s international development plans have also targeted new geographic areas, particularly<br />

Tunisia, where <strong>Benetton</strong> Tunisia S.a.r.l., a wholly-owned subsidiary, has begun the production of an<br />

initially limited range of products, and Oporto (Portugal), where <strong>Benetton</strong> Lda., another wholly-owned<br />

subsidiary, has been formed for manufacturing and distribution purposes.<br />

An additional 50% of the capital stock of United Colors of <strong>Benetton</strong> do Brasil S.A. was acquired in<br />

December 1995 with a view to strengthen management control of the <strong>Group</strong>'s production and<br />

marketing structure in Brazil.
